Getting Around:
Shaver Lake is a small mountain town, and getting around is simple—but having your own vehicle is essential. There is no Uber or Lyft service in the area, so we recommend planning to drive during your stay.
The village, local shops, and restaurants are just a short drive away, and many homes are within about a 10–15 minute walk to town depending on location. The lake, marina, and trailheads are also easily accessible by car within a few minutes.
During the winter months, road conditions can change quickly. A 4WD or AWD vehicle with chains or cables is strongly recommended, and sometimes required, depending on weather conditions.
